McDavid is just mind-blowing. And if you watch a whole game, you see that every single time he's on the ice he creates a quality scoring chance. It's unreal. There's never been a player like him, that has his skating/hands/IQ combo.

He reminds me of Crosby a little, for that reason I wouldn't say I haven't seen a player like him.

 

Crosby's IQ is every bit as good, and with that, passing, vision, etc. McDavid's skating smoothness and acceleration is unparalleled in today's game, it's Orr-like. But Sid is very fast as well and has more power. More like Forsberg. So I'd call that a wash. McDavid's hands are better, but Crosby's shot is better, particularly backhand which is among the best I've seen.

 

Sid is more of a grinder, McDavid more finesse. For this reason I see Crosby's game suited to the playoffs a little better. Both amazing players, I think McDavid will have a chance to equal the numbers Sid has put up, but ultimately I think Sid's come I'm a little higher. No chance McDavid puts up 120 like Sid did in year 2. But part of that is that goal scoring is down.

 

In the end I think these two guys will be seen as the top tier of this generation, easily.
